X-Git-Url: http://matita.cs.unibo.it/gitweb/?p=helm.git;a=blobdiff_plain;f=matita%2Fmatita%2Fcontribs%2Flambdadelta%2Fground%2Frelocation%2Fgr_fcla.ma;h=5ab8b1decef58cd34ecf2fc2d766f06112897830;hp=8a533cbe1bfefaf5ea0945d533d9ef5ba65a4a32;hb=2ed8d2abcc3b0687141b627061b63350a0b200bd;hpb=b367de0252e88d6b0476648d5ceac7e4aeffca27 diff --git a/matita/matita/contribs/lambdadelta/ground/relocation/gr_fcla.ma b/matita/matita/contribs/lambdadelta/ground/relocation/gr_fcla.ma index 8a533cbe1..5ab8b1dec 100644 --- a/matita/matita/contribs/lambdadelta/ground/relocation/gr_fcla.ma +++ b/matita/matita/contribs/lambdadelta/ground/relocation/gr_fcla.ma @@ -16,7 +16,7 @@ include "ground/notation/relations/rfun_c_2.ma". include "ground/arith/nat_succ.ma". include "ground/relocation/gr_isi.ma". -(* FINITE COLENGTH ASSIGNMENT FOR GENERIC RELOCATION MAPS ***********************************************************) +(* FINITE COLENGTH ASSIGNMENT FOR GENERIC RELOCATION MAPS *******************) (*** fcla *) inductive gr_fcla: relation2 gr_map nat ≝ @@ -32,7 +32,7 @@ interpretation "finite colength assignment (generic relocation maps)" 'RFunC f n = (gr_fcla f n). -(* Basic inversion lemmas ***************************************************) +(* Basic inversions *********************************************************) (*** fcla_inv_px *) lemma gr_fcla_inv_push (g) (m): 𝐂❪g❫ ≘ m → ∀f. ⫯f = g → 𝐂❪f❫ ≘ m. @@ -54,7 +54,7 @@ lemma gr_fcla_inv_next (g) (m): 𝐂❪g❫ ≘ m → ∀f. ↑f = g → ∃∃n ] qed-. -(* Advanced inversion lemmas ************************************************) +(* Advanced inversions ******************************************************) (*** cla_inv_nn *) lemma gr_cla_inv_next_succ (g) (m): 𝐂❪g❫ ≘ m → ∀f,n. ↑f = g → ↑n = m → 𝐂❪f❫ ≘ n.